Artist History
I spent many years playing drums with bands mainly in the Pop/Rock genre,playing lots of gigs and recording a few albums. I now concentrate my efforts writing and producing my own instrumental music and playing with a Prog/Classic Rock band called Tr3nity. Tr3nity are signed to a small independant label called Cyclops and we have released one album so far called 'The Cold Light Of Darkness'.We are in pre production for our second release due out in the Autumn. I currently have three self produced albums called 'Twister', 'Sahara', and 'Inter Alia'. |

Press Reviews
Reviews
New Horizons
For full review see New Horizons website
"A criticsm often levelled at this genre is that the common practice of using drum machines tends to take a lot of the soul out the music; but here is an act that turns the tables on that particular problem. Being a drummer, the live show features Rolf playing drums to recorded backing tracks, which gives an added vibrancy and texture to the sound - which is atmospheric in the extreme.
I'd be hard pressed to favour either one of these CDs above the other since, in truth, I have found both to be immensely enjoyable. This is great mood music, and is perfect to play when you want to wind down or chill out. The content demonstrates variety and inventiveness throughout and, since the tracks are concise and do not resort to over indulgence, they tend to hold the attention very well indeed."
"While the nature of the music is clearly likely to appeal to fans of Electronic / Ambient bands such as Tangerine Dream or Foreign Spaces, and even at times OMD; there is more than enough here to find favour with a far wider ranging audience. Regardless of your current tastes, I would strongly encourage readers to check out the Maengan web site where sound samples for all the tracks featured on these albums can be found and, if you like what you find, contact the artist to obtain the CDs."
Simon, 21st August 2002

Additional Info
Maengan, pronounced mar-en-gun, is the word for a wolf in the language of the Ojibwe tribe. My name, Rolf, is a German word that means wolf. |
